Justin Murisier (born 8 January 1992) is a Swiss World Cup alpine ski racer who competes in giant slalom, super-G and downhill. Earlier, he also competed in slalom.

Career

Born in Martigny, Valais, Murisier has competed at three Winter Olympics{{cite web |url=http://www.sochi2014.com/en/athlete-justin-murisier |title=Justin Murisier |website=Sochi2014.com |publisher=Organizing Committee of the XXII Olympic Winter Games and XI Paralympic Winter Games of 2014 in Sochi |accessdate=22 February 2014 |archive-date=21 February 2014 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20140221200232/http://www.sochi2014.com/en/athlete-justin-murisier |url-status=dead }} and five World Championships. His first World Cup podium came in December 2020 at Alta Badia, Italy, and his first win came in December 2024 in the downhill at Beaver Creek, Colorado, USA.
